Asset Manager
National Cooperative Bank
VA or OH Office Serve as a loan servicing liaison between the Real Estate Team, NCB’s operating departments and customers relative to pending and existing real estate accounts, with a special emphasis on Commercial Real Estate loan servicing which includes NCB’s portfolio loans, loans sold to Fannie Mae and sold into CMBS pools and their compliance under the related loan sale servicing agreements while exceeding customer needs. Responsibilities The asset manager will track and review preliminary and full loan packages for real estate loans, act as a conduit for accuracy of data at loan closing, maintain accurate and organized credit files on borrowers, and input loan related data for new loans into the McCracken Strategy Loan Servicing System and Strategy Web Portal. 40% Address internal and external customer inquiries in a timely manner both telephonically and by email, proactively manage, research, identify and resolve payment problems and other borrower related issues, analyze and interpret data regarding billing related inquiries, interest rate changes and other critical loan information, review property inspections and monitor deferred maintenance until cured, and review daily system exception reports to identify and resolve loan system irregularities. 20% Monitor ongoing loan activity to ensure the borrower remains in compliance with the Lender terms and conditions, maintain data integrity accuracy rate of 98% regarding new loan setup, and a minimum 85% overall receipt rate for Strategy Web Portal loan covenant documentation updates. 15% Proactively manage, research, identify and resolve payment problems, monetary and non‑monetary delinquencies and other borrower related issues, follow up on past due loan payments, manage loan maturity, document measures taken and correspondence with borrowers, coordinate with Investor Compliance, and release draw requests on lines of credit as needed. 15% Set up capital improvement, replacement reserves and tax and insurance escrow accounts, monitor and maintain early escrows, resolve all post‑closing engineering and environmental items within required timeframes, and manage replacement reserve escrows. 10% Minimum Qualifications College degree preferred with 3+ years’ experience in the loan administration function servicing commercial and/or multifamily loans under Agency and CMBS guidelines.
